Output 80e04db328177d334ef3aecceeade4efe5b850704d79f9d3294e8ca5ad5ca498:15

value
26971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32dcc6d0406ab55255772cb851df58ac714499ba OP_EQUAL
address
36KxBxqCq6DQopzcWAb78m8EXV6q1V7ape
transaction
80e04db328177d334ef3aecceeade4efe5b850704d79f9d3294e8ca5ad5ca498
confirmations
144541
spent
true